How they compare
Palau currently reports 11.8% against 11.7% in Saint Kitts and Nevis,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Saint Kitts and Nevis ahead.
Palau ranks 87th and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 89th of 218 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Palau averaged higher in 1 and Saint Kitts and Nevis in 6.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Palau | Saint Kitts and Nevis |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 4.6% | 5.8% | 1.1%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 1970s | 4.5% | 8.1% | 3.6%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 1980s | 5.3% | 9.5% | 4.3%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 1990s | 5.6% | 8.8% | 3.2%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2000s | 5.5% | 7.4% | 1.9%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2010s | 7.5% | 7.8% | 0.3%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2020s | 10.6% | 10.5% | 0.1% | Palau |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Population ages 65 and above as a percentage of the total population. Population is based on the de facto definition of population, which counts all residents regardless of legal status or citizenship.
